QUICK REFERENCE WEDDING CHECKLIST

◊  Estimate the total number of guests you will have, as that will be a key element to getting proper information from all vendors

◊  Have a tentative date or list of date options ready when contacting businesses

◊  Start looking for vendors in your area, or where you will be getting married, who will meet your needs

◊  Set a budget early in the planning process

◊  Begin searching for a ceremony location and a reception location that both meet your date and space need (selecting menus and planning details with each facility will come later, although menu selection is often important to stay within your budget)

◊  Select a wedding officiate to perform your services

◊  Request information from service providers such as a bakery for your cake, a caterer if your reception facility does not offer on-premise catering, entertainment, florist/décor, invitations, photographers, spa or salon services and transportation

◊  Shop for your bridal gown, groom’s attire, bridal party attire and accessories

◊  If you have guests that need lodging in the area during your special event, estimate the number of rooms you need and the dates.  In some areas, you can contact The Convention & Visitors Bureau with your information and they will send your request to all of the local hotels so you may receive information on rates and availability from all of them with just one call, and they may also assist with the process of blocking hotel rooms for your wedding.  Be sure to inquire of these details to make sure you know what you will be responsible for doing, and don’t be afraid to ask for names and numbers of others who may help with this process!

◊  Select  shower and rehearsal dinner facilities

◊  Review licensing information (as provided in this site or otherwise) and apply for your marriage license

◊  Finalize all details with your vendors.  There are a number of tasks and decisions to make with each business and they will individually walk you through the process.
